Hospital Services
(Nashville General Hospital)
Roger Zoorob, M.D., M.P.H., F.A.A.F.P., professor and chair of the Department of Family and Community Medicine at Meharry Medical College and professor and director of Family Medicine at Vanderbilt University will lead the Department of Family & Community Medicine Hospitalist Physician Group. This group manages adult patients, newborns, and pregnant women presenting for delivery. This group consists of six full-time family physicians, which are certified by the American Board of Family Medicine.
Family Medicine is a field that specializes in complete care of family medical problems. Our physicians manage a variety of hospitalized patients, and possess the training, expertise, and technology to take care of transferred patients as well. These physicians each fulfill faculty appointments in the Department of Family and Community Medicine at Meharry School of Medicine, and support a program of 18 residents training to become primary care family doctors.
Physicians include: Millard Collins, M.D., Mohamad Sidani, M.D., M.S., Gerardo Rodriguez, M.D., Vincent Morelli, M.D., Ruth Stewart, M.D., Jayshree Nathan, M.D., and Roger Zoorob, M.D., M.P.H., F.A.A.F.P. Upon discharge from the hospital, patients will be seen for follow-up and outpatient care at 3 clinics in Nashville: the Medical Arts Center at 1919 Charlotte Street, the Meharry Family Medicine Center at 1005 DB Todd Blvd, and Madison Family Medicine and Obstetrics, located at Madison Square Shopping Center on Gallatin Road.
These clinics handle all primary care and hospital follow-up needs Monday through Friday, on an appointment and walk-in basis.
